Compared with the solution electrospinning, melt electrospinning has a broad application prospet in filtration and biological medicine and other fields because of its wide raw material, non-toxic, pollution-free and higher product productivity. At the same time, the research and design and development of industrial equipment of melt electrospinning are still in the primary stage, so the research of melt industrialization of electrospinning equipment has a practical significance.Based on the laboratory equipment of single nozzle melt electrospinning, the high efficient electrospinning melt spinning nozzle of special structure was designed, that is the cone nozzle of the wind auxiliary. The melt electrospinning test-bed was built. The process parameters of melt electrospinning were researched. The influences of the melt flow rate, melt temperature, electric field intensity, auxiliary airflow and air velocity on the fiber diameter were analyzed.Based on the melt electrospinning of test-bed and the study of the process parameters, the related parameters of the spinning nozzle were optimized by ANSYS finite element. The electrospinning melt nozzle of industrialization equipment was designed. The overall scheme of melt electrospinning production line was analyzed. The whole melt electrospinning production line was assembled and the experiments of melt electrospinning were conducted research, the experimental results are ideal.The air filtration performance of melt electrospinning fiber membrane has been studied. The influences of fiber diameter and thickness of fiber membrane on air filtration performance were analyzed. |
